CVE-2007-5940: Medium severity Tug Texlive 2007 vulnerability
Published Nov 13, 2007
·Updated
feynmf.pl in feynmf 1.08, as used in TeXLive 2007, allows local users to overwrite arbitrary files and execute arbitrary code via a symlink attack on the feynmf$$.pl temporary file.
